TaylorMade Rocketbladez vs M4 Irons

I’m fairly new to golf. A good friend of mine has let me borrow an older used set of clubs and now I’m looking to buy some new ones. I’m looking for game improvement irons and I think I’ve narrowed it down to the Taylormade Rocket Bladez and M4.

For those of you that have experience with both of these irons, which would you recommend? I can get the Rocket Bladez for almost $200 cheaper. Are the M4’s worth the extra $?

If I'm not mistaken the Rocket Bladez are an older set somewhere around 2012,  not sure?  The M4 are 2018 model.   There is a big difference in technology between the two.    I have the M4 and love them but the shaft makes up a very big overall difference.

The standard operating procedure around here will be to tell you to go hit both on a launch monitor and get the numbers.   The numbers won't lie.   I don't know your financial background so I can't say if the $200 is significant for you.   But if you look at the longevity of the clubs over time, $200 over time isn't that expensive.  

Whatever you do, even without a launch monitor, go hit both if you are limiting your search to just these two.
